@kevin2fla If you're diabetic, your body gets hungry, even though you just ate. The reason was there is no or minimal insulin available to transport the energy to your muscles. So, your body goes through catabolism, using your fats or protein from muscle to get the fuel the body needs. That's why you have ketoacidosis because the protein and fats are floating around your blood system.
